A Micro Electronics Manufacturer:
- Operates and monitor process equipment including manual, automatic and semi- automatic manufacturing equipment to produce micro-electronic products
- Sets up process equipment and adhere to clean room procedures
- Performs some or all the following tasks with the above mentioned process equipment using micro-electronic manufacturing equipment to spin coat, photo align, develop, etch, measure, implant oxides, sputter, print, test, inspect, measure, dice and bake
- Identifies and mark/record defective products
- Collects, record and summarize inspection and test results
- Operates various testing equipment and tools
- Compares test results to specifications and take action
- Maintains detailed and complete process result reports
- Maintains a product tracking system
- Participates in continuous process improvement programs
